Talking about pandemics with kids can feel fraught, but thoughtful resources can turn anxiety into understanding. This free “Pandemic: Causes, Cures, and Responses” unit study from Teachers Pay Teachers weaves readings, timelines, map work, and simple experiments into a multidisciplinary look at epidemiology and history. Designed for upper elementary and middle school, it helps students explore how diseases spread, how communities respond, and what public health looks like in practice. Parents appreciate that it’s structured yet flexible, with printable materials and clear guidance. Sensitive content is inherent—you’ll discuss illness and death—so it won’t be right for every family or every moment, but for many, it provides a framework for hard conversations. Pro tip: preview all materials, skip anything that feels too heavy for your child right now, and pair the unit with hopeful examples of cooperation and scientific breakthroughs.
